1. What Are AI-Driven Learning Systems?

AI-driven learning systems are advanced educational platforms that use machine learning algorithms and big data analytics to create personalized learning paths for students. These platforms track student progress, engagement, and performance to tailor lessons, quizzes, and assignments to the specific needs of each learner.

Key Features of AI-Driven Learning Systems

  • Personalized Learning Paths: Custom lesson plans based on student progress.
  • Real-Time Feedback: Immediate feedback on assignments, quizzes, and tests.
  • Predictive Analytics: Early detection of at-risk students who need extra support.
  • Automated Grading: AI systems that evaluate assignments and provide detailed feedback.
  • Data-Driven Insights: Reports that offer insights into student engagement, learning gaps, and performance.

These systems aim to create a dynamic, flexible, and adaptive learning experience for students, enabling them to learn at their own pace while providing teachers with actionable insights to support student growth.

2. How AI-Driven Learning Systems Work

AI-driven learning systems use sophisticated algorithms to track and analyze vast amounts of student data. By understanding how students interact with lessons, assignments, and quizzes, AI creates personalized learning experiences.

How It Works

  1. Data Collection: AI collects data on student performance, engagement, and progress.
  2. Data Analysis: Machine learning algorithms analyze the data to identify patterns and trends.
  3. Customization: The system personalizes lesson plans, study materials, and assignments for each student.
  4. Feedback and Recommendations: Students receive instant feedback on their performance, while teachers receive actionable recommendations for targeted interventions.

This continuous cycle of data collection, analysis, and customization ensures that students have access to the most effective learning experience possible.

4. Adaptive Assessments

AI systems can adjust the difficulty of tests and quizzes in real time based on student performance. This adaptive assessment approach ensures that students are neither over-challenged nor under-challenged.

How Adaptive Assessments Help Students:

  • Test difficulty increases when students answer correctly and decreases if they answer incorrectly.
  • Students experience a sense of challenge without feeling overwhelmed.
  • It builds confidence as students tackle questions that match their ability.

Adaptive assessments keep students motivated, encouraging them to push their limits while maintaining a positive learning experience.
